Excel 2007
 
Where are the formula icons in Excel 2007, i.e., the plus, minus, etc.. I
had them on my 2000 toolbar for quick access.

ShaneDevenshire

Excel 2007
 
Hi Marie,

For my reference, why do you use those rather than just typing?

In 2007 choose Office Button, Excel Options, Customize, on the top right
pick Commands Not in the Ribbon from the Choose commands from drop down. You
will find the buttons you are looking for here. Select a button, click Add
button.
